The concept of ‘human dignity’ denotes the intrinsic and superlative worth associated with human beings in virtue of which we owe them utmost moral regard. Although dignity is a foundational concept for African philosophy, there remains scant literature in African philosophy dedicated to critical and systematic reflection on the concept of human dignity. This volume responds to this lacuna by bringing together chapters that offer philosophical exposition, defense (or even rejection) and application of the concept of human dignity in light of intellectual resources in African cultures, such as ubuntu, personhood, and serithi.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":50464112574737,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 GARDNERS","offer_id":50464113426705,"sku":"NGR9783031373404","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52120891359505,"sku":"NLS9783031373404","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/3031373405.jpg?v=1750729280"},{"product_id":"african-ethics-and-death-book-motsamai-molefe-9781032658407","title":"African Ethics and Death","description":"This book analyzes the concepts of moral status and human dignity in African philosophy and applies them to the moral problems associated with death. The books is aimed at scholars of philosophy interested in non-European and specifically African perspective.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51061119222033,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51061121810705,"sku":"NIN9783030932169","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52340549452049,"sku":"NLS9783030932169","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/3030932168.jpg?v=1751252381"},{"product_id":"african-ethics-of-personhood-and-bioethics-book-motsamai-molefe-9783030465186","title":"An African Ethics of Personhood and Bioethics","description":"This book articulates an African conception of dignity in light of the salient axiological category of personhood in African cultures. The idea of personhood embodies a moral system for evaluating human lives exuding with virtue or ones that are morally excellent. This book argues that this idea of personhood embodies an under-explored conception of dignity, which accounts for it in terms of our capacity for the virtue of sympathy. It then proceeds to apply this personhood-based conception of dignity to bioethical questions, specifically, those of abortion and euthanasia. Regarding abortion, it concludes that it is impermissible since foetuses possess partial moral status. Regarding euthanasia, it argues that it is permissible for reasons revolving around avoiding the reversing of personhood. It also, though, minimally, touches on the questions regarding the mentally disabled and animals, to which it assigns lower moral status.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51061474001169,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51061477245201,"sku":"NIN9783030465186","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/3030465187.jpg?v=1750806024"},{"product_id":"african-personhood-and-applied-ethics-book-motsamai-molefe-9781920033699","title":"African Personhood and Applied Ethics","description":"\u003cp\u003eRecently, the salient idea of personhood in the tradition of African philosophy has been objected to on various grounds. Two such objections stand out - the book deals with a lot more. The first criticism is that the idea of personhood is patriarchal insofar as it elevates the status of men and marginalises women in society. The second criticism observes that the idea of personhood is characterised by speciesism. The essence of these concerns is that personhood fails to embody a robust moral-political view.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cem\u003eAfrican Personhood and Applied Ethics\u003c\/em\u003e offers a philosophical explication of the ethics of personhood to give reasons why we should take it seriously as an African moral perspective that can contribute to global moral-political issues. The book points to the two facets that constitute the ethics of personhood - an account of (1) moral perfection and (2) dignity. It then draws on the under-explored view of dignity qua the capacity for sympathy inherent in the moral idea of personhood to offer a unified account of selected themes in applied ethics, specifically women, animal and development.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51105768636689,"sku":"NIN9781920033699","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52533851816209,"sku":"NLS9781920033699","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/1920033696.jpg?v=1751413226"},{"product_id":"african-ethics-and-death-book-motsamai-molefe-9781032658469","title":"African Ethics and Death","description":"This book analyzes the concepts of moral status and human dignity in African philosophy and applies them to the moral problems associated with death.
